Every
teenager remembers that day, the day where they finally pass their
written driver’s exam and can get behind the wheel. After months
of studying, listening to parents discuss driver responsibility, and
learning to obey traffic signs and signals, they seem more than
ready, right? Well, not ready enough, seeing as approximately 34,000
people die each year as a result of driving in the United States
alone. Driving can be a major benefit to one’s life, but at the
same time, it can be the event that ends it.

Driver
education is a vital aspect of a teenager’s journey to becoming a
responsible driver. These classes play a significant role in
reducing the number of deaths as a result of driving. Each student
is provided with a driver’s manual. Every page contains rules and
a plethora of information on how to become a responsible driver.
These educational classes are taught by a teacher who goes over what
is in the handbook. The instructors also engage prospective drivers
in activities to prepare them for the written exam. Some classes
have access to driving simulations, where students can “get behind
the wheel” in class and practice driving through cones and parallel
parking. Drivers ed is essential for training new drivers and
reducing the number of deaths that occur while driving.
